Suspected leak

Hey guys,

I have what seems to be a leak from the part in the attached picture, anyone knows the part #?

It's on a 17' SS

Thanks in advance!!

Maybe I am blind but it’s a little difficult seeing a leak in your pictures. Maybe circle the area and upload the files again? That being said the belt tensioners on LT1’s are known to leak and I do see the tensioner in your close up. If so just google “2017 camaro SS belt tensioner” and it should come up. Had mine replaced on my 2016 1SS I used to own.
